Notice of the Reorganization of Three Otsuka Group Companies (Otsuka Pharmaceutical Factory, Otsuka Warehouse, and Taiho Pharmaceutical) as Wholly Owned Direct Subsidiaries
- * This press release is an English translation of Otsuka Holding's press release issued on July 25, 2008 in Japanese. The original Japanese language press release is available on www.otsuka.com.
Tokyo, Japan -- At a board of directors' meeting held on July 25, Otsuka Holdings, Co., Ltd. (Head office: Chiyoda-ku, Tokyo, Japan; President: Tatsuo Higuchi; hereafter Otsuka Holdings) decided to make three of its companies into wholly owned direct subsidiaries through a corporate revision and exchange of shares. The three companies concerned are Otsuka Pharmaceutical Factory, Inc. (hereafter Otsuka Pharmaceutical Factory), Otsuka Warehouse Co., Ltd. (hereafter Otsuka Warehouse), and Taiho Pharmaceutical Co., Ltd. (hereafter Taiho Pharmaceutical). The share exchange is conditional on obtaining the approval of the general meeting of shareholders. As a result of the reorganization, Otsuka Holdings' wholly owned direct subsidiary Otsuka Pharmaceutical Co., Ltd. (hereafter Otsuka Pharmaceutical), will be joined by Otsuka Pharmaceutical Factory, Otsuka Warehouse, and Taiho Pharmaceutical and all four companies will operate as direct subsidiaries of Otsuka Holdings.
1. Aim of the redivision and exchange of shares
Otsuka Holdings was established on July 8, 2008 with the aim of establishing a corporate governance system under which it will set strategy for the group's businesses, allocate business resources, and play an overseeing and supervisory role.
This reorganization of three group companies into wholly owned direct subsidiaries is aimed at strengthening group management with Otsuka Holdings at the center.
- As a result of redivision (a "Kyushu-bunkatsu"),Otsuka Holdings will assume certain rights held by Otsuka Pharmaceutical in relation to share management. Accordingly, Otsuka Pharmaceutical Factory will become a direct subsidiary with Otsuka Holdings owning 60% of its shares, and Otsuka Warehouse will become a wholly owned subsidiary of Otsuka Holdings.
- Otsuka Holdings will exchange shares to become the sole parent company of Otsuka Pharmaceutical Factory and the latter will be its wholly owned subsidiary.
- As a result of redivision (a "Kyushu-bunkatsu"),Otsuka Holdings will assume certain rights in relation to the management of shares in Otsuka Pharmaceutical Factory and Otsuka Warehouse. As a result, Taiho Pharmaceutical will become a direct subsidiary of Otsuka Holdings with Otsuka Holdings owning 52.7% of its shares.
- Otsuka Holdings will exchange shares to become the sole parent company of Taiho Pharmaceutical and the latter will be its wholly owned subsidiary.

2. Schedule for corporate reorganization and share exchanges (as expected following July 26)
July 25, 2008 | Board of directors meets to decide corporate reorganization and share exchanges (Otsuka Holdings) Signing of corporate reorganization and share exchange agreements |
---|---|
August 20, 2008 | Extraordinary general meeting of shareholders to approve share exchanges (Otsuka Holdings) |
October 1, 2008 | Corporate reorganization between Otsuka Holdings and Otsuka Pharmaceutical comes into effect (shareholding ratios: Otsuka Pharmaceutical Factory 60%, Otsuka Warehouse 100%) |
October 31, 2008 | Share exchange between Otsuka Holdings and Otsuka Pharmaceutical Factory comes into effect (shareholding ratio: Otsuka Pharmaceutical Factory 100%) |
November 1, 2008 | Corporate reorganization between Otsuka Holdings, Otsuka Pharmaceutical Factory, and Otsuka Warehouse comes into effect (shareholding ratio: Taiho Pharmaceutical 52.7%) |
January 1, 2009 | Share exchange between Otsuka Holdings and Taiho Pharmaceutical comes into effect (shareholding ratio: Taiho Pharmaceutical 100%) |

Reference: Aim of establishing Otsuka Holdings
Otsuka Holdings was established as the group's holding company on July 8, 2008. While making the most of the characteristics of each business company, Otsuka Holdings aims to realize synergies and enhance the value of the entire group on an ongoing basis. Its aims are to:
- Strengthen the holding company as the core of group business
The holding company's aim is to establish a corporate governance system through the setting of strategy for the group's business, allocating business resources, and playing an overseeing and supervisory role. - Maximize synergies by controlling business resources
Using the group's business resources, reinforce management capability and product solutions, promote overseas business development, and strengthen R&D capability. - Seek business efficiencies
By promoting shared services, try to standardize and centralize head office functions in the group such as purchasing, distribution, and IT, and try to streamline business and reduce costs. - Vitalize personnel and the organization
Based on the holding company, build a foundation for lively people-to-people exchange within the group and global personnel development.
